
It will be the ninth match for both teams in the 2023 ICC ODI World Cup. South Africa occupies second place with 12 points in the 2023 World Cup team table, while Afghanistan occupies sixth place in the table with 8 points.
In their first match, South Africa defeated Sri Lanka by 102 runs at the Arun Jaitley Cricket Stadium in Delhi on 7 October 2023. In their second match, the Proteas defeated Australia by 134 runs on 12 October 2023, at Ekana Cricket Stadium Lucknow.
In their third match, Netherlands defeated the Proteas by 38 runs at HPCA Stadium Dharamsala, on 17 October 2023. In their fourth and fifth matches, South Africa defeated England (October 21) and Bangladesh (October 24) by 229 and 149 runs respectively.
In their sixth match, South Africa defeated Pakistan by one run (with 16 balls remaining) at the MA Chidambaram Stadium Chennai on 27 October 2023. In their match, South Africa defeated New Zealand by 190 runs at the MCA Stadium. In Pune on November 1. The Proteas were defeated by India in their eighth match at Eden Gardens by 243 runs on 5 November.
In their first match, Bangladesh defeated Afghanistan by 6 wickets (with 92 balls remaining) at HPCA Stadium, Dharamshala on 7 October. In their second match, Afghanistan were defeated by India by 8 wickets (with 90 balls remaining) at the Arun Jaitley Cricket Stadium. Delhi Stadium on October 11 in their third match. Afghanistan defeated England by 69 runs at the Arun Jaitley Cricket Stadium in Delhi on October 15.
In the fourth match, Afghanistan defeated New Zealand by 149 runs at the MA Chidambaram Stadium in Chennai on October 18. In the fifth match, Afghanistan defeated Pakistan by 8 wickets (with 6 balls remaining) at the MA Chidambaram Stadium in Chennai on 23 October. .
In the sixth match, Afghanistan defeated Sri Lanka by 7 wickets (with 28 balls remaining) at the MCA Stadium Pune on 30 October. In their seventh match, Afghanistan beat Netherlands by 7 wickets (with 111 balls remaining) at the Ikana Cricket Stadium Lucknow in November. 3. In their eighth match, Afghanistan lost to Australia by three wickets (with 19 balls remaining) at Wankhede Stadium in Mumbai on 7 November.
South Africa potential XI
Quinton de Kock (wk), Temba Bavuma (captain), Rassie van der Dussen, Aiden Markram, Heinrich Klaassen, David Miller, Marko Janssen, Keshav Maharaj, Kagiso Rabada, Lungi Ngidi/Andile Phlukwayo, Tabriz Shamsi/Gerald Coetzee.
Afghanistan Possible XI
Rahmanullah Gurbaz, Ibrahim Zadran, Rahmat Shah, Hashmatullah Shahidi (captain), Azmatullah Omarzai, Mohammad Nabi, Ikram Alikhil (week), Rashid Khan, Mujibur Rahman/Fazlul Haq Farooqi, Naveen ul Haq, Noor Ahmed.
South Africa vs Afghanistan: weather forecast
Weather conditions in Ahmedabad are set to be foggy. According to AccuWeather, there is a slight possibility of rain in Ahmedabad. Temperatures are expected to range between 36 degrees to 22 degrees Celsius.
The wind is expected to blow at a speed of about 7 km/h in the northeastern direction during the day, and 6 km/h in the north-northeast direction at night. The possibility of winds reaching speeds of 15 km/h cannot be ruled out during the next 24 hours. There is no possibility of cloud cover in the next 24 hours.
